Meet Steve Archibald!

Lawyer, blogger, husband, ABTA Mentor and brain tumor survivor.

After Steve's struggle, he went on to become an ABTA mentor for those effected by brain tumors in the Denver Metro area. For 3 years, Steve has been helping families navigate through this difficult journey through group meetings, blogging, community outreach and more.

Steve is partnering with Swing Fore ABTA - Denver 2020 to help get the word out to the local community and we are honored to have him be a part of the team!
